What is the Puffco Proxy and how does its modular design work?
The Puffco Proxy is a portable, modular vaporizer design that separates the electronic heating base from the glass body, allowing for high-level customization. Unlike traditional all-in-one units, the Proxy base drops into a sherlock-style body (the "Pipe") but remains compatible with a massive ecosystem of third-party glass. This device utilizes a ceramic 3D chamber where heating tracers are embedded in the ceramic walls, not just the bottom. This ensures the oil vaporizes on the side walls when you inhale, preserving flavor and efficiency better than standard bottom-heated coils.

Which temperature settings and RGB lighting options are available?
The Puffco Proxy utilizes four distinct color-coded heat settings to manage vaporization intensity.
· Blue (Low): ~490°F – Best for flavor.
· Green (Medium): ~510°F – Balanced vapor and flavor.
· Red (High): ~530°F – High vapor production.
· White (Peak): ~545°F – Maximum density.
With the New Proxy, users get enhanced RGB lighting control. Through the Puffco app, you can engage "Mood Lights" to pulsate or dim the LED ring for stealth. This RGB lighting isn't just aesthetic; it provides status indicators for battery life and heat cycles.
What is included in the Puffco Proxy kit?
The Puffco Proxy kit ships with everything required to start a session immediately, emphasizing a minimalist, developer-friendly unboxing experience. Inside the box, you will find:
· The Proxy Base (the core engine).
· The Sherlock-style body (Glass Pipe).
· A 3D Chamber.
· A Joystick Cap (provides directional airflow).
· Loading tool, Dual Tools (cotton swabs), and a USB-C cable.
The Puffco Proxy kit is the foundation of a modular vaporizer design. Because the base is removable, you can eventually move it to different "hosts," such as a bubbler or a water pipe adapter.
How do Boost Mode and session timing impact performance?
Boost Mode extends your session time and increases the temperature for a short burst to finish a bowl efficiently. You activate this by double-clicking the button during an active heat cycle.

When should you perform an atomizer replacement?
You should perform an atomizer replacement when the chamber no longer heats evenly, displays connection errors (Red-White flashes), or has permanent chazzing (black residue). The 3D chamber is a consumable part.
The cost of a 3D chamber replacement is roughly $60. Unlike older wire-based coils, the 3D chamber is robust, but routine cleaning is required to prolong its life. If you notice a significant drop in vapor production even on the White setting, an atomizer replacement is likely due.
Can you use the device while charging?
Yes, the Puffco Proxy supports pass-through charging, meaning you can use it while it is plugged in via USB-C. However, the battery must have a minimal charge (it cannot be dead flat).
The battery typically lasts for about 15 heat cycles per full charge. For heavy users, carrying a battery pack is recommended.
How do you clean the Puffco Proxy properly?
Safe maintenance requires 90% or higher Isopropyl Alcohol (ISO).
1. Chamber: Soak the 3D chamber in ISO only when it has cooled down completely to avoid thermal shock.
2. Glass: The sherlock glass can be soaked and rinsed with warm water.
3. Base: Never soak the base. Use an ISO-dampened swab to clean the connection points.
Regular cleaning prevents the need for premature atomizer replacement and keeps the sherlock-style body free of reclaim.
